RNF14FTC562R Equivalent & Substitute Parts
Part Overview
The RNF14FTC562R is a 562 Ohms ±1% 0.25W axial through-hole resistor manufactured by Stackpole Electronics Inc. This metal film resistor features flame retardant coating and safety construction, designed for applications requiring precision resistance values with tight tolerance specifications. The part is Active status and ROHS3 compliant. Substitute parts are identified when equivalent electrical specifications and mechanical compatibility exist within the allowed parameter ranges for this resistor category.

Substitute Part Grouping Explanation
Substitute parts for the RNF14FTC562R are identified based on the following critical parameters that determine functional equivalence:
Core Electrical Parameters (Must Match):
- Resistance value: 562 Ohms
- Tolerance: ±1%
- Composition: Metal Film
- Temperature Coefficient: ±50ppm/°C
Mechanical Compatibility:
- Package Type: Axial through-hole configuration
Compliance Requirements:
- RoHS3 Compliant status
- REACH Unaffected status
Two substitute parts meet these criteria with the following distinctions:
CMF50562R00FHEB - Manufacturer Recommended substitute with identical power rating (0.25W) and extended operating temperature range (-55°C ~ 175°C). Identical electrical performance with enhanced thermal capability.
CMF55562R00FHEB - Upgrade substitute with increased power rating (0.5W) and extended operating temperature range (-55°C ~ 175°C). Provides higher power dissipation capability while maintaining identical resistance and tolerance specifications.

Engineering Selection Recommendations
CMF50562R00FHEB is the manufacturer-recommended direct substitute. It maintains identical electrical specifications and power rating while providing extended operating temperature capability to 175°C. Both parts are Active status and ROHS3 compliant. The CMF50 series adds moisture resistance features and is available in higher inventory quantities.
CMF55562R00FHEB serves as an upgrade option when higher power dissipation is required in the circuit design. The 0.5W rating provides additional thermal margin compared to the original 0.25W specification. This part maintains all electrical parameters and compliance certifications while offering enhanced reliability in power-dissipation-sensitive applications.
Both substitute parts are suitable for direct replacement in applications where the RNF14FTC562R is specified, provided circuit design parameters do not require the specific lower operating temperature limit of the original part.
